Telltale Games’ episodic adventure video game, The Walking Dead, is coming back for a third season, as outed at the San Diego Comic-Con.

The news comes from Telltale President Kevin Bruner and The Walking Dead Comic Creator Robert Kirkman, who have confirmed the plans to make a third season of the narrative-driven, episodic video game.

For now, no details regarding a prospective release date or story-related information have been revealed, but taking into account the fact that the game’s second season is still incomplete, it’s likely to be a while until we see The Walking Dead Season 3.

Telltale Games is also planning to make Game of Thrones and Borderlands adaptations, that will be delivered in the same consecrated manner, with an emphasis on storyline, tense moments and difficult moral decisions.

Considering how much the company already has on its plate and taking into account the release schedule of former installments in The Walking Dead series, with Season 1 released in April 2012, and Season 2 in December 2013, it’s likely that The Walking Dead Season 3 will be out sometime in early 2015.
